Output d6d5a64fec30372e4d0fb20e16e81d3bec04cfd61ba1d9b33e103c5bd5c74e91:1

value
23883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f18be6761995e8436b413c13c7681d95488c36 OP_EQUAL
address
3NCQeTWGN98kwHdFJJwdTV235fqDaaUa9e
transaction
d6d5a64fec30372e4d0fb20e16e81d3bec04cfd61ba1d9b33e103c5bd5c74e91
confirmations
406112
spent
true